I got some for my motorcycles, and after installing them in two 
different bikes, got concerned with how directional they seemed to be.  
One of the bikes, a HD Sportster, was okay because the bulb points back 
parallel with the road.  On the other, a 1981 Virago, the bulb points 
downward and depends on a reflector to spread the beam.  It seemed to be 
much less bright than the incandescent bulb if you viewed at an angle 
slightly off center.  So it never stayed in that bike.  Didn't seem as 
safe and/or obvious to following traffic.  I don't know if this was 
peculiar to the brand I got, but I would suggest you check carefully to 
see if you lose any apparent brightness.
